Why Do I Need a Ledger for Crypto?

1. Enhanced Security

One of the primary reasons for using a crypto ledger is its exceptional security features. A ledger is a digital device that stores private and public keys, which are essential for accessing and managing your cryptocurrency assets. Unlike traditional wallets, ledgers offer offline storage, making them immune to online hacking attempts and malware attacks.

2. Protection Against Phishing Attacks

Ledgers provide an added layer of security by requiring physical interaction to access your digital assets. This means that even if you fall victim to a phishing attack, your cryptocurrency is safe as you won't be able to access your ledger without the physical device.

3. Multi-Currency Support

Crypto ledgers are designed to support a wide range of cryptocurrencies, making them a versatile choice for investors and traders. You can store various digital assets, including Bitcoin, Ethereum, Litecoin, and other altcoins, in a single device, simplifying your cryptocurrency management.

4. Backup and Recovery

Ledgers allow you to create backups of your private and public keys, ensuring that you can recover your cryptocurrency assets in case of device loss or damage. By securely storing your backups, you can maintain full control over your digital assets without relying on third-party services.

5. Easy to Use

Despite their advanced security features, crypto ledgers are designed to be user-friendly. They come with intuitive interfaces and clear instructions, making it easy for both beginners and experienced users to manage their cryptocurrency assets.
